Roles related to folklore and literature preservation require a deep understanding of cultural heritage, historical context, and various preservation techniques.
Here's a quick overview of the roles and their respective demand in the UK job market. 1. Folklore Archivist: Folklore archivists collect, preserve, and catalogue various forms of folklore, such as traditional songs, stories, and customs.
They collaborate with museums, libraries, and research institutions to ensure the long-term preservation of these cultural treasures. 2. Literature Conservator: Literature conservators specialize in the preservation and restoration of printed and manuscript materials.
They assess the condition of literary works, implement conservation strategies, and prevent future damage through proper handling and storage techniques. 3. Curator (Folklore & Literature): Curators manage and develop collections in museums, libraries, and other cultural institutions.
They conduct research, plan exhibitions, and engage the public through educational programs and events. 4. Museum Education Specialist: Museum education specialists develop and implement educational programs, workshops, and events for various audiences.
They create learning materials, design interactive experiences, and collaborate with educators and community organizations. 5. Cultural Preservation Consultant: Cultural preservation consultants advise organizations on best practices for preserving and promoting cultural heritage.
They provide guidance on conservation techniques, exhibition planning, and public engagement strategies.
